This 3D printing system produces excessive-definition, full-color prototypes quickly and cheaply.
In line with energyspecialists 3D printing uses commonplace inkjet printing know-how to create elements layer-by-layer by depositing a liquid binder onto thin layers of powder. Instead of feeding paper underneath flexibleprint heads like a 2D printer, a 3D printing system strikes energyprint heads over a mattress of powder upon which it prints why Choosecross-sectional data. There advantagespowder is distributed accurately and evenly across the construct platform through benefitsuse of a feed piston and platform, which rises incrementally for each layer. A curler mechanism spreads powder fed from advantagesfeed piston onto the build platform. So as soon as magnificencelayer of powder is spread, modellinginkjet print heads print pros ofcross-sectional area for the first, or backside slice of the half onto the sleek layer of powder, binding powerpowder together. After that a piston lowers the build platform by 0.1 mm, and a brand new layer of powder is spread on top. Why Choose 3D Printingprint heads beautifully apply the info for the next cross section onto the new layer, which binds itself to the earlier layer. Chiefly, this 3D printing course of is repeated for the entire layers till the physical mannequin is made.
And lastly, some technical information. So, customary lead time is minimal of 3 working days. Customary accuracy is ± 0.2%. Layer thickness is 0.1 mm. In truth, dimensions are unlimited as parts may be composed of several sub-parts.
